WebThe same can be done in C# using the methods available in the File class provider. Generally reading from a file is performed using the two methods ReadAllText (file) and ReadAllLines (file), where the file denotes the file that needs to be read. WebFeb 8, 2024 · // Read a text file line by line. string[] lines = File.ReadAllLines( textFile); foreach (string line in lines) Console.WriteLine( line); One more way to read a text file is using a StreamReader class that implements a TextReader and reads characters from a byte stream in a particular encoding.
